Background
- Scope and content:
-
San Bernardino Public Library's photograph collection includes images of family life, work life, daily activities in the community that would be of historical interest to the people of San Bernardino and surrounding areas. Our photographs cover a period from the late 1878 to 1999. The collection includes family photos from some prominent area families including Hirata family; Holcomb family; Caddell family; Santini family and Valles family.
- Acquisition information:
- This collection was created by San Bernardino Public Library staff in 2003-2004. The images were received on June 19, 1999 Photo Day, under the Shades of San Bernardino project, funded by the California State Library Shades of California Program and Library Services and Technology Act.
